To tell the truth I had no idea where we were going with this thing in the early game, I just let the chips fall where they lie and worked out the puzzle from there and this is what we got. This deck centered around our key cards. Those cards were two copies of Echo Form, playing one on another would then give us THREE stacks of our Echo buff, copying the first THREE cards we would play. Then, cards like an upgraded Buffer would give us two turns on intangibility, but doubled making it FOUR turns. Cards like Hand of Greed filled our coin purses with gold to spend on a wide array of things. Things like relics, cards, removals, potions.. But Hand of Greed also was 2 mana often times deal 25 or even 50+ damage in a single turn. It was our bread and butter big damage ability until we started to become more of a orb based build. We grabbed a Defragment and Biased Cognition along our run and that allowed us to stack our focus up to insane numbers when played on Echo Form turns, often turns making our electric orbs do 15+ damage each, and our frost orbs giving us 20~ block each. I'm trying to blab less about these deck details, but some of the key relics that really enabled our late game were things like Data Disc, giving us MORE focus for free, things like Bottled Flame allowing us to start with the Hand of Greed in our opening hand hoping to one shot weaker mobs for gold, Meat on the Bone and Lizard Tail were nice insurnace on our run, and things like Pen Nib always help in those massive hits.
